How to Set Up for Your First Specimen Carp Session — Gear Checklist
Here's your step-by-step checklist for gear for the anglers looking to get going:
- Rods/reels: 2-3 test curve rods, bait runners for runs.
- Line: 12-15lb mono mainline, fluorocarbon leaders.
- Bivvy/alarm: Weatherproof shelter, bite alarms with receivers.
- Bait: Ground bait mix, boilies, corn – fresh and varied.
- Rigs: Hair rigs with size 8-10 hooks.
- Landing gear: 42" net, unhooking mat, scales.
Set up at dawn, bait up, cast out. Patience pays!
